A Modern forgery of a Roman provincial coin, possibly dating to the 19th-early 20th century. The obverse depicts the bust of Antoninus Pius, facing right. The inscription reads ΑVΤ ΚΑΙСΑΡ ΑΔΡΙΑΝΟС ΑΝΤΩΝΙΝΟС (Augustus Caesar Hadrianus Antoninus). The reverse depicts Demeter standing in biga drawn by winged and coiling serpents,advancing right, holding a long torch. The inscription reads ΘΕΑ ΔΗΜΗΤΡΙ ΝΕΙΚΑΙΕΙС (Goddess Demeter of Nicaea).

Modern cast copper alloy drop handle. It is subtriangular with a square suspension loop at its apex, and divides into two curved projections at the base. There is a raised, moulded triangle on the main body of the mount. It is 38.77mm long, 23.65mm wide, 4.11mm thick and weighs 11.5 grams.

Modern (18th to 19th century) cast lead toy cannon. Formed of a hollow cylinder which decreases in diameter from 15.02mm to 8.9mm. it is 59.50mm long, has a maximum thickness of 23.52mm and weighs 21.5 grams.
